What a wonderful facility with an amazing lodge named Annie's House; named in remembrance of Annie who died on the twin towers on 9/11. Botno winter park offers ski and snowboard lessons, snow tubing and all equipment can be rented and fitted in house. The staff is wonderful and this is a real treat considering its located in northern North Dakota.

Well run small ski area, great for new skiers/boarders. Triple chair with no lines. Also has tubing runs with magic carpet shared with bunny hill. Newer large chalet with food and place for parents to hangout while kids ski/board/tube. Love this place.

I travel to this area due to my role as an alpine ski coach in Manitoba. The lodge facility is unparalleled in the region as a result of community and charitable efforts and investment for the creation of an adaptive training centre. This has provided the infrastructure to support one of the most active ski racing clubs in the region. Really shows what an investment in superior winter sports facilities close to a population centre can accomplish.
